The Defense Logistics Agency has awarded SEQUOIA DEFENSE LLC a contract valued at $592,382.00 for the performance of a Government First Article Test and the supply of a Control Wheel, Aircraft, identified by NSN/Part number 1680011086542 and purchase request 7011764574. The award, issued under solicitation SPE4A7-25-Q-1254, was posted on DIBBS on July 24, 2026, and is classified under NAICS code 336413, which pertains to aircraft manufacturing. The contract does not specify a set-aside type or a designated point of contact, and the place of performance is not explicitly defined, though the agency is a federal entity operating under the Department of Defense. The work is focused on validating the initial production article to ensure compliance with technical specifications prior to full-scale manufacturing and delivery.

The Defense Logistics Agency, through DLA Land and Maritime, has issued Request for Quotations SPE7L7-26-Q-2412 for the procurement of 100 nickel-cadmium wet storage batteries (NSN 6140-01-241-2296). These batteries are specified as wet, discharged, and spillable, with a non-extendable shelf life of 36 months. Approved sources include Aerodesign, Inc. (P/N AD-31004-04C) and Marathonnorco Aerospace, Inc. (P/N 31004-04C). The items are to be delivered to the Royal Saudi Air Force within 60 days after the order date. This is a fixed-price solicitation where award will be based on the best value to the government, evaluating technical conformity, past performance, and offered delivery time. Because the batteries are classified as corrosive materials (UN2795), the contractor must strictly adhere to hazardous materials regulations, including ICAO, IMDG, 49 CFR, and AFJMAN 24-204. Packaging must comply with MIL-STD-2073-1E Level B, Pack Code Q, using 4G fiber-board boxes. Inspection will be conducted by DCMA at the distributor or OEM site, with acceptance occurring at the origin. Administrative requirements include the use of the Wide Area WorkFlow system for electronic invoicing and receiving reports. The contract incorporates various FAR and DFARS clauses, including the Buy American and Balance of Payments Program and strict cybersecurity reporting requirements under DFARS 252.204-7012. Quotes must be submitted electronically by the deadline of September 17, 2026.
